The So What

China's Ministry of Commerce is drafting export-control language that would bar Huawei, Alibaba, ByteDance and other domestic chip designers from sending their most advanced designs to TSMC and other foreign foundries 1 2 3. Read as pure industrial policy, it looks like Beijing finishing the decoupling Washington started. Read against what SMIC can actually deliver this year, it looks more like Beijing choosing to ration its own AI buildout rather than let TSMC keep doing it for free.

What Is Actually Being Proposed

The measures under review would fold into the next revision of China's catalogue of technologies restricted from export, and they go beyond foundry access 1 2. Regulators are also weighing curbs on transferring advanced AI models and the training data behind them, plus tighter scrutiny of Chinese firms' overseas technology acquisitions 3. All of it is still at the industry-feedback stage, nothing has been formally enacted, but the direction is unambiguous: keep frontier AI development, from training data to the silicon it runs on, inside Chinese borders 1 2 3.

The foundry piece is the one investors should watch first. Chinese fabless designers have spent years having their most advanced dies etched at TSMC on nodes SMIC cannot yet match at volume, even as the finished chips were assembled into systems and deployed domestically. A formal ban would close that gap on Beijing's own timeline rather than Washington's.

Why the Timing Reads as Leverage, Not Just Policy

The proposal surfaced the same window Washington opened its own review of how Chinese AI firms reach Nvidia chips through offshore subsidiaries and shell entities, after a run of Chinese model breakthroughs made clear existing restrictions were being routed around 4. Chinese buyers including ByteDance, Alibaba and Tencent have placed orders for more than 400,000 Nvidia H200 units this year, chips Nvidia's own finance chief has said have generated no recognized China revenue because delivery keeps getting tangled in the compliance fight 4. A Chinese ban on its own firms using TSMC lands as a mirror-image pressure point: if Washington can choke offshore chip access, Beijing can choke offshore chip fabrication.

The Capacity Math Beijing Would Be Betting On

This is where the policy runs into physics. SMIC's advanced-node capacity, 7-nanometer and below, sat near 45,000 wafer starts per month at the end of 2025, and industry trackers expect it to climb to roughly 60,000 by the end of 2026 and 80,000 in 2027, with early 5-nanometer pilot runs already underway for partners including Huawei and Alibaba 6. That wafer capacity alone could, in principle, bake die for well over a million Huawei Ascend-class accelerators a year 5 6.

The constraint sits one layer downstream, in memory. High-bandwidth memory is what turns a finished logic die into a usable AI accelerator, and China's only qualified domestic HBM supplier, CXMT, is projected to produce enough stacks next year for something like 250,000 to 300,000 Ascend-class chips, even as SMIC's die output runs far ahead of that number 5 6. Analysts tracking the ramp believe China's stockpile of foreign HBM, built up before controls tightened, ran out in late 2025, meaning every chip built from here depends on CXMT's memory line keeping pace with SMIC's wafers, which it currently does not 5 6.

Who Would Actually Get Squeezed

Huawei is targeting roughly 750,000 Ascend chip shipments in 2026, and ByteDance and Alibaba are reportedly lining up orders for Huawei's chips as a domestic hedge against tightening access to Nvidia 7. Layer a formal TSMC ban on top of that demand and the queue does not shrink, it just becomes captive. Every designer currently splitting orders between TSMC and SMIC would be pushed entirely onto a supply chain that, by its own trackers' estimates, can fully serve well under a third of the demand it would suddenly own 5 6 7. The near-term effect is not more Chinese AI chips reaching the market, it is longer wait times and tighter rationing among Huawei, Alibaba and ByteDance for the CXMT memory that gates all of them.

TSMC, meanwhile, has less exposure to lose than the policy debate implies. Chinese decoupling pressure from Washington has already pushed TSMC's revenue mix toward North American customers, who accounted for the bulk of sales in the company's most recent quarter, with AI accelerator demand from Nvidia and AMD doing the heavy lifting 8. A Chinese self-imposed ban would formalize a shift that United States export rules had already been driving for three years.

What to Watch

Three signals will show whether this becomes real: whether the catalogue revision actually gets published rather than staying in consultation, whether CXMT's HBM output tracks its 2026 projections or slips the way China's foreign-HBM stockpile already did, and whether Huawei's next-generation Ascend 950-series ramp gives Beijing enough domestic output to make the ban politically affordable. Until CXMT closes the memory gap, a formal TSMC ban is a stronger statement of intent than an operational reality, and the investors most exposed are not TSMC shareholders but the Chinese AI developers who would be first in line for a supply chain that cannot yet fill its own orders.
